another vote for stage 8s. I had all sorts of leaks with the bbk bolts that came with my headers, trashed them got some stage 8s for like $40 and no leaks. Did that like a year ago. A little more expensive but well worth it if it prevents that aggravation of replacing header gaskets.

Percy's aluminum gaskets, and Stage-8 locking bolts=no leaks!

breslin alittle more money than stage 8, but no retainers and no clips to lose. they also have smaller heads than the stage 8 bolts. and are available in stainless if that's your thing. summit and jegs carry them.
